The Kollmorgen CTP32NLF11KAA00 is a stepper motor in the CT Stepper Motors series. It features a size 34 frame, two-stack length, and a straight keyway shaft with a radial load capacity of 65 pounds at the shaft center and an axial shaft load of 100 pounds in both directions. The motor has a bipolar winding, four lead connections, a rated current per phase of 1.1 amps, and an insulation voltage rating of 340 VDC.

Product Description:
The CTP32NLF11KAA00 is a hybrid stepper motor manufactured by Kollmorgen within the CT Stepper Motors series. Supplied under the Cool Torque Performance designation, it is intended for precise incremental positioning in pick-and-place stations, indexing tables, and other open-loop motion axes used in industrial automation. By converting drive current into controlled rotary steps, it removes the need for feedback devices in many medium-torque applications. That arrangement suits machines that value straightforward drive control and dependable step-by-step motion without added feedback hardware.
The motor occupies a Size 34 / 8.5 cm frame, so it can replace legacy NEMA 34 devices without mechanical changes. At its rated phase current, the CTP winding delivers 7.8 N-m of holding torque, providing margin for high-inertia loads. Each phase draws 1.1 A, which helps limit drive heating while still energizing the laminated core. Insulation is rated to 340 VDC, allowing safe operation on microstepping drives that switch high bus voltages for improved slew rates. The rotor end is machined with a straight keyway shaft, and the axial bearings tolerate 100 lbs of load in either direction, enabling direct coupling to lead screws or belt pulleys without auxiliary thrust bearings. This current level also helps keep thermal load manageable in tightly packed equipment.
Mechanical installation is simplified by the NEMA through holes mounting pattern and the two-stack lamination length, which increases torque without enlarging the motor face. Radial bearing capacity is limited to 65 lbs at the shaft center, helping protect the assembly when side loads from pulleys are present. Electrical hookup uses flexible leads with four conductors because the winding is bipolar, allowing series or parallel drive options. There are no rear-mounted encoders or brakes, which helps keep the overall length short. The leaded connection style also simplifies routing in compact machine sections where connector depth can become a constraint.
Frequently Asked Questions about CTP32NLF11KAA00:
Q: What is the maximum axial load the CTP32NLF11KAA00 motor can support?
A: The CTP32NLF11KAA00 stepper motor supports an axial shaft load of 100 lbs (45 kg) in both directions.
Q: What is the bipolar holding torque for the CTP32NLF11KAA00 with CTP winding?
A: This motor provides a bipolar holding torque of 7.8 N-m when using the CTP winding type.
Q: What is the connection style and number of connections for the CTP32NLF11KAA00 motor?
A: The connection style is leads with four available connections on this model.
Q: What type of shaft does the CTP32NLF11KAA00 stepper motor utilize?
A: The shaft is a straight keyway type, enabling secure coupling with compatible mechanical systems.
Q: What mounting style is provided for the CTP32NLF11KAA00 motor?
A: CTP32NLF11KAA00 features a mounting style that uses NEMA through holes for easy installation.
